The option between battery-powered and electric tools is a common consideration for gardeners. Below, we detail the advantages of both:
Battery-Powered ToolsMobility: Cordless models offer flexibility of movement, enabling you to tackle big garden areas without being limited by power cables.Benefit: Easy to start and operate without fretting about an electrical outlet.Versatility: Many Battery Power Tools Dewalt-powered tools work with other Dewalt Hand Tools power tools, allowing for multiple-use batteries.Electric ToolsPower Output: Generally more powerful than battery-operated tools, making them appropriate for heavier-duty tasks.Weight: Electric tools are frequently lighter than their gas-powered counterparts, making them much easier to handle.Hands-On Operation: Users do not require to stress about battery life during usage, permitting undisturbed work during a session.Choosing the Right DeWalt Garden Tools
Picking the proper tools can substantially affect gardening efforts, whether you're preserving a small vegetable garden or managing larger landscaping jobs. Below are some elements to consider:
1. Kind of Gardening
Determine the type of gardening you intend to do-- flower gardening, veggie gardening, landscaping, or yard maintenance-- as this will direct your tool selection.
2. Scope of Work
Think about the scale of jobs you need to achieve. Smaller sized gardens may need a couple of hand tools, while larger jobs might require more comprehensive equipment like tillers or blowers.
3. Battery Life
For those choosing battery-powered tools, think about the anticipated run-time and charging time of the tool. Some designs offer extended battery life suitable for extended use.
4. Ergonomics
Choose tools that are comfortable to use. Ergonomic handles lower pressure and tiredness, which is essential for extended gardening sessions.
5. Sturdiness
DeWalt tools are known for their ruggedness, but it's still important to confirm build quality. Go with rust-resistant products and robust construction to endure outdoor conditions.
6. Cost
Budget factors to consider can assist your tool choice. DeWalt offers a range of products at various rate points, so designate a budget while researching functions.

A: Yes, lots of DeWalt garden tools work with the exact same battery systems used in their additional power tools. This enables more practical battery management.
Q2: How long do DeWalt batteries last on a single charge?
A: Battery life varies by tool and usage, but DeWalt batteries can last anywhere from 30 minutes to several hours, depending on the specific tool and work.
Q3: Are DeWalt garden tools easy to keep?
A: Generally, DeWalt garden tools are developed for lower upkeep needs. Regular cleaning and periodic sharpening are usually adequate for ideal performance.
Q4: What warranty do DeWalt garden tools come with?
A: Most DeWalt garden tools include a guarantee ranging from 3 to 5 years, covering problems in products and craftsmanship.
Q5: Can I buy replacement parts for DeWalt garden tools?
A: Yes, DeWalt offers replacement parts and devices for many of their garden tools, which can usually be acquired through their website or authorized dealers.
